Principle of the method

The schematics bellow presents the CLEAN-T algorithm implemented in this repository.

Note

The subject is supposed in this example to be a plane but it can be any object as long as you provide its trajectory and a possible source grid sourounding it.

As depicted in the central part of the schematics, CLEAN-T is based on the used of the time-domain formulation of moving source propagation and beaforming to iteratively :

  • compute the beamforming over the given grid (or focal plan)

  • localise the maximum

  • isolate the temporal signal comming from the maximum location

  • propagate the signal to the microphones

  • substract the propagated signals to the previously stored signals

CLEAN-T Schematics

If a multi-frequency analysis is performed, the left block of the schematics is performed in order to filter each microphone signal in the moving-source related domain (thus dedopplerising, filtering and re-dopplering the signals).
